Factorise y2+8y+16 completely.

To factorise the quadratic equation y^2 + 8y + 16 completely, we need to find two numbers that multiply to 16 and add to 8.

Step 1: Identify the numbers The numbers that satisfy these conditions are 4 and 4, because 4*4 = 16 and 4+4 = 8.

Step 2: Rewrite the equation We can rewrite the equation as y^2 + 4y + 4y + 16.

Step 3: Factor by grouping Now, we can factor by grouping. The first two terms, y^2 + 4y, can be factored to y(y + 4). The last two terms, 4y + 16, can be factored to 4(y + 4).

Step 4: Combine like terms Since both terms are now the same (y + 4), we can combine them to get (y + 4)^2.

So, the factorised form of y^2 + 8y + 16 is (y + 4)^2.
